Paperless Ngx#

Paperless Ngx is a document management system that allows you to digitize and organize your paper documents. This guide will also walk you through installing gotenberg and tika on your cluster.

Installation#

  1. Create the following directory structure for Paperless Ngx:
  paperless-ngx/
  ├── db.yml
  ├── ingress.yml
  ├── svc.yml
  ├── pvc.yml
  ├── paperless-ngx.yml
  ├── gotenberg.yml
  └── tika.yml
  1. Add the following content to db.yml:
---
apiVersion: apps/v1
kind: StatefulSet
metadata:
  name: paperless-ngx-db
  namespace: tools
spec:
  selector:
    matchLabels:
      app: paperless-ngx-db
  serviceName: paperless-ngx-db
  replicas: 1
  template:
    metadata:
      labels:
        app: paperless-ngx-db
    spec:
      containers:
      - name: paperless-ngx-db
        image: docker.io/library/redis:8
        ports:
        - containerPort: 6379
        volumeMounts:
        - name: paperless-ngx-db
          mountPath: /data
          subPath: redis
  volumeClaimTemplates:
  - metadata:
      name: paperless-ngx-db
    spec:
      accessModes: ["ReadWriteOnce"]
      resources:
        requests:
          storage: 500Mi
      storageClassName: longhorn
  1. Add the following content to ingress.yml:
---
apiVersion: networking.k8s.io/v1
kind: Ingress
metadata:
  name: paperless-ngx-ingress
  namespace: tools
  annotations:
    cert-manager.io/cluster-issuer: letsencrypt-cloudflare
    traefik.ingress.kubernetes.io/router.middlewares: tools-authelia@kubernetescrd
    traefik.ingress.kubernetes.io/router.entrypoints: websecure
spec:
  ingressClassName: traefik
  tls:
  - hosts:
    - ngx.example.com
    secretName: paperless-ngx-tls
  rules:
  - host: ngx.example.com
    http:
      paths:
      - path: /
        pathType: Prefix
        backend:
          service:
            name: paperless-ngx-service
            port:
              number: 8000
  1. Add the following content to svc.yml:
---
apiVersion: v1
kind: Service
metadata:
  name: paperless-ngx-service
  namespace: tools
spec:
  selector:
    app: paperless-ngx
  ports:
  - port: 8000
    targetPort: 8000

---
apiVersion: v1
kind: Service
metadata:
  name: paperless-ngx-db
  namespace: tools
spec:
  selector:
    app: paperless-ngx-db
  ports:
  - port: 6379
    targetPort: 6379
  clusterIP: None

---
apiVersion: v1
kind: Service
metadata:
  name: gotenberg-service
  namespace: tools
spec:
  selector:
    app: gotenberg
  type: ClusterIP
  ports:
  - port: 3000
    targetPort: 3000

---
apiVersion: v1
kind: Service
metadata:
  name: tika-service
  namespace: tools
spec:
  type: ClusterIP
  selector:
    app: tika
  ports:
  - port: 9998
    targetPort: 9998
  1. Add the following content to pvc.yml:
---
apiVersion: v1
kind: PersistentVolumeClaim
metadata:
  name: paperless-longhorn
  namespace: tools
spec:
  accessModes:
    - ReadWriteOnce
  volumeMode: Filesystem
  resources:
    requests:
      storage: 1Gi
  storageClassName: longhorn
  1. Add the following content to paperless-ngx.yml:
---
apiVersion: apps/v1
kind: Deployment
metadata:
  name: paperless-ngx
  namespace: tools
spec:
  strategy:
    type: Recreate
  selector:
    matchLabels:
      app: paperless-ngx
  template:
    metadata:
      labels:
        app: paperless-ngx
    spec:
      containers:
      - name: paperless-ngx
        image: ghcr.io/paperless-ngx/paperless-ngx:2.20.8
        ports:
        - containerPort: 8000
        env:
        - name: PAPERLESS_REDIS
          value: "redis://paperless-ngx-db.tools.svc.cluster.local:6379"
        - name: PAPERLESS_URL
          value: "https://ngx.example.com"
        - name: PAPERLESS_TIME_ZONE
          value: "Etc/UTC"
        - name: PAPERLESS_TIKA_ENABLED
          value: "1"
        - name: PAPERLESS_TIKA_ENDPOINT
          value: "http://tika-service.tools.svc.cluster.local:9998"
        - name: PAPERLESS_TIKA_GOTENBERG_ENDPOINT
          value: "http://gotenberg-service.tools.svc.cluster.local:3000"
        volumeMounts:
        - name: data
          mountPath: /usr/src/paperless/data
          subPath: data
        - name: data
          mountPath: usr/src/paperless/media
          subPath: media
        - name: data
          mountPath: /usr/src/paperless/export
          subPath: export
        - name: data
          mountPath: /usr/src/paperless/consume
          subPath: consume
      volumes:
      - name: data
        persistentVolumeClaim:
          claimName: paperless-longhorn
  1. Add the following content to gotenberg.yml:
apiVersion: apps/v1
kind: Deployment
metadata:
  name: gotenberg
  namespace: tools
spec:
  selector:
    matchLabels:
      app: gotenberg
  template:
    metadata:
      labels:
        app: gotenberg
    spec:
      securityContext:
        runAsUser: 1001
      containers:
      - name: gotenberg
        image: gotenberg/gotenberg:8.27
        command:
        - sh
        - -c
        - |
          gotenberg --chromium-disable-javascript=true --chromium-allow-list=file:///tmp/.*
        ports:
        - containerPort: 3000
        securityContext:
          readOnlyRootFilesystem: false
          allowPrivilegeEscalation: false
          privileged: false
  1. Add the following content to tika.yml:
apiVersion: apps/v1
kind: Deployment
metadata:
  name: tika
  namespace: tools
spec:
  selector:
    matchLabels:
      app: tika
  template:
    metadata:
      labels:
        app: tika
    spec:
      containers:
      - name: tika
        image: apache/tika:3.2.3.0
        ports:
        - containerPort: 9998
  1. Commit and push the changes to your Git repository. Flux will automatically deploy the resources to your cluster.
